Resolve to Save Lives partners with the Federal Ministry of Health of Ethiopia, the World Health Organization (WHO) and Johns Hopkins University to support hypertension control and sodium reduction initiatives.

Prevent Epidemics provides technical assistance directly or through partners, mobilizes resources to support preparedness and drives political support to address epidemic preparedness gaps. Programmatic interventions include laboratory strengthening, disease surveillance, legal support, rapid response funding and program management/governance.

Prevent Epidemics partners with the Ethiopian Public Health Institute to embed an A-Team, a multidisciplinary team working across government offices to help plan and implement a range of activities required to accelerate epidemic preparedness.

Prevent Epidemics partners with the Ethiopian Public Health Institute to improve health care worker safety, including via strengthening infection prevention and control (IPC) measures, which keep health care workers and patients safe from avoidable infections.

Prevent Epidemics partners with the Ethiopian Public Health to implement the 7-1-7 approach to rapid performance improvement for early disease detection and response.
